Transaction edeffead359e006de1c97636d494b8891587558443e9e3719eac7542246abe58
1 Input
1 Output
-
edeffead359e006de1c97636d494b8891587558443e9e3719eac7542246abe58:0
- value
- 698935
- script pubkey
- OP_0 OP_PUSHBYTES_20 2fd8938625a80f20ef02ce12f3f8db13f1d1dd7a
- address
- bc1q9lvf8p394q8jpmczecf087xmz0carht6ghee8j